How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Brookline?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Brookline Studio Apartments | $658 | $589 | $750 |
Brookline 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,118 | $678 | $1,999 |
Brookline 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,258 | $822 | $1,900 |
Brookline 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,889 | $1,125 | $2,700 |
Brookline 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,411 | $1,295 | $1,645 |

Getting Around the Brookline Neighborhood in Pittsburgh, PA
Walk Score®
65 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
31 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
41 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
